企业微信接口定制开发如何保证开发质量

我有开发需求

  • 联系电话:

    *
  • 7+1等于

有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。

随着企业微信的普及,越来越多的企业开始使用企业微信作为内部沟通协作的工具。企业微信提供了丰富的接口,可以让开发者根据企业的需求进行定制开发。但是,如何保证开发质量呢?下面,我将从需求分析、设计、开发、测试和部署等五个方面来探讨如何保证企业微信接口定制的开发质量。
一、需求分析
在进行企业微信接口定制开发之前,首先需要进行需求分析。需求分析是整个开发过程的基础,如果需求分析不清晰,就会导致开发出来的产品与实际需求不符,从而影响开发质量。在进行需求分析时,需要充分了解企业的业务流程和需求,同时要考虑到企业微信的特点和功能。例如,企业微信支持消息推送、通讯录管理、会议安排等功能,可以在需求分析时结合这些功能来设计接口。此外,在需求分析时还需要注意以下几点:1. 确定接口的功能和性能要求,例如接口的响应速度、并发量等。2. 确定接口的输入输出参数和返回值,以及数据格式的规范。3. 确定接口的安全性要求,例如身份验证、权限控制等。4. 确定接口的兼容性要求,例如是否支持多种浏览器、多种操作系统等。
二、设计
在需求分析的基础上,进行接口的设计。设计是开发过程中非常重要的一步,可以确保接口的实现符合需求,并且具有可扩展性、可维护性和稳定性。在设计时,需要考虑以下几点:1. 确定接口的架构和实现方式,例如采用哪种编程语言、使用哪种框架等。2. 设计接口的详细流程和处理逻辑,例如接口的输入输出参数的处理、业务逻辑的处理等。3. 设计接口的界面和交互方式,例如界面布局、操作流程等。4. 考虑接口的异常处理和错误提示,例如输入参数的校验、业务逻辑的错误处理等。
三、开发
在设计的基础上,进行接口的开发。开发是整个过程的核心,需要确保代码的质量、可读性和可维护性。在开发时,需要遵循以下几点:1. 采用最佳的编程实践,例如命名规范、注释规范等。2. 编写单元测试用例,确保代码的正确性和稳定性。3. 采用重构技术,保持代码的可读性和可维护性。4. 遵循安全性原则,例如检查输入参数的合法性、防止SQL注入等。
四、测试
在开发完成后,进行接口的测试。测试是确保接口质量的最后一步,可以发现接口存在的问题,并确保接口符合需求。在测试时,需要考虑以下几点:1. 进行全面的测试,例如功能测试、性能测试、安全测试等。2. 采用自动化测试技术,提高测试效率。3. 进行回归测试,确保接口在修改后依然符合要求。4. 进行压力测试,确保接口在高并发量下依然能够正常运行。
五、部署
在测试完成后,进行接口的部署。部署是整个过程的最后一步,也是非常重要的一步,可以确保接口能够被用户正常访问。在部署时,需要考虑以下几点:1. 确定接口部署的环境和硬件配置,例如服务器、操作系统、数据库等。2. 进行接口的配置,例如端口号、域名等。3. 进行接口的监控,例如性能监控、故障监控等。4. 定期备份接口的数据,以防止数据丢失。

有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。